The Elysian Fields Yellowjackets are taking a road trip to square off against the Timpson Bears at 8:00 p.m. on Friday.
On Tuesday, Elysian Fields was within striking distance but couldn't close the gap as they fell 54-49 to Gary.
Meanwhile, Timpson earned a 67-60 victory over Waskom on Tuesday.
Timpson is on a roll lately: they've won four of their last five games. That's provided a nice bump to their 15-14 record this season. The wins came thanks in part to their offensive performance across that stretch, as they averaged 56.6 points over those games. As for Elysian Fields, their defeat dropped their record down to 16-7.
Elysian Fields strolled past Timpson in their previous meeting back in January by a score of 65-46. The rematch might be a little tougher for the Yellowjackets since the squad won't have the home-court advantage this time around. We'll see if the change in venue makes a difference.
